Purpose of the Role
To safely and efficiently deliver and collect goods from customers while providing excellent customer service and ensuring all deliveries are completed accurately and on time.
Key Responsibilities
- Drive a 3.5-tonne vehicle in accordance with road traffic laws and company policies.
- Load, secure, transport and unload goods safely.
- Complete scheduled deliveries and collections within designated time frames.
- Carry out daily vehicle safety and defect checks.
- Obtain customer signatures or electronic proof of delivery.
- Plan routes efficiently and communicate any delays or issues.
- Handle delivery paperwork and use handheld scanning devices where required.
- Provide courteous and professional customer service.
- Keep the vehicle clean and report any maintenance issues.
- Follow all health and safety procedures, including safe manual handling.
